EUR/JPY Price Forecast: Eyes rising wedge top near 187.00

Source Fxstreet
  • EUR/JPY trades within a rising wedge pattern, targeting the upper boundary at 186.80.
  • The 14-day Relative Strength Index around 60 suggests constructive upside momentum
  • The initial support lies at the nine-day EMA of 185.94.

EUR/JPY extends its gains for the fourth consecutive day, trading around 186.50 during the Asian hours on Friday. The currency cross is maintaining a bullish near-term bias as price holds above both the nine-period and 50-period Exponential Moving Averages (EMAs). The positioning above these trend filters, together with a 14-day Relative Strength Index (RSI) around 60, suggests constructive upside momentum while stopping short of overbought territory.

The daily chart technical analysis shows an ascending triangle has morphed into a rising wedge, signaling a shift from bullish accumulation to market exhaustion, typically indicating a strong bearish reversal risk.

The EUR/JPY cross is positioned within the rising wedge, with targeting the upper boundary around 186.80. Further advances would support the currency cross to navigate the region around the all-time high of 187.95, which was recorded on April 17.

On the downside, the initial support lies at the nine-day EMA of 185.94, with additional backing at the 50-day EMA of 185.26, aligned with the lower boundary of the rising wedge. Further declines below the wedge put downward pressure on the EUR/JPY cross to navigate the region around the five-month low of 181.87, recorded on March 16, and the seven-month low of 180.81.

The heat map shows percentage changes of major currencies against each other. The base currency is picked from the left column, while the quote currency is picked from the top row. For example, if you pick the Euro from the left column and move along the horizontal line to the US Dollar, the percentage change displayed in the box will represent EUR (base)/USD (quote).
